Eastern Meadowlark In Oaks and Prairies Population Forecast

If the recent trend holds, Eastern Meadowlark in Oaks and Prairies is projected to fall about 100% by 2030 — from 17 in 2025 to a central estimate of 0.00 (95% range 0.00–39). A 5-year backtest shows a typical error of ±102.6%, with 100% of held-out values landing inside the 95% band.
